fyqt.net
当前位置:首页 >> js oBjECt lEngth >>

js oBjECt lEngth

你用for(var each in record){ alert(each); } 查看一下对象中都有什么属性然后再用。

单个对象是没有length属性的,obj.length --- undefined 如果返回的是一个数组,会有length属性的,例如:var divObjs = document.getElementsByTagName("div"); 这个是会返回一个div的数组的。 你说的“可是如果不是数组,objxxx.length依然...

1.针对标签对象元素,比如数html页面有多少个段落元素 那么此时的$("p").size() == $("p").length 2 .计算一个字符串的长度或者计算一个数组元素的个数 那么此时只能用length而不能用size()

原生的话可以使用for循环 for(var i=0;i

1、"object"是字符串,typeof后,js默认有6中字符串,"number," "string," "boolean," "object," "function," 和 "undefined.",用来判断对象的类型,这里判断是否是Object类型。 2、"Object"字符串,应该是判断自定义对象类是不是继承Object之...

js 数组去重 注:应该也可以适用于 object数组,但是本人没有进行验证,贴出来仅供你参考第一种是比较常规的方法思路:1.构建一个新的数组存放结果2.for循环中每次从原数组中取出一个元素,用这个元素循环与结果数组对比3.若结果数组中没有该元...

用反射。 1 2 3 4 5 6 7 8 9 10 11 public static void main(String[] args) throws IllegalArgumentException, IllegalAccessException { // TODO Auto-generated method stub String s = "abc"; Field[] f = s.getClass().getDeclaredFields()...

理解为创建一个数字array, 怎么初始化呢,就是,创建个数组长度为array.length(长度已赋值对象个数尔定)的数组array。并且把新创建对象赋值给它,对象就是object(包含属性),

可以去雨林木风之类的专业平台。百度里这种人才还是少了点。

js 产生undefined的情况: 1. var outObj = { type :"java" } function innerM(){ var p; alert(p);//undefined alert("k:"+k);//error--innerObj未定义 alert(outObj.jack);//undefined alert(innerObj.jack);//error--innerObj未定义 } innerM...

网站首页 | 网站地图
All rights reserved Powered by www.fyqt.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com